Eons

Eons

A Natural History of Mars (2023x14)


Air date: May 09, 2023

While Earth’s natural history has been playing out over the last few billion years, another epic planetary saga has also been unfolding right next door.

  • Premiered: Jun 2017
  • Episodes: 326
  • Followers: 2
  • Running
  • YouTube
  • at 13